Care & Maintenance of large bore mri machine

Care & Maintenance of large bore mri machine

Scheduled performance audits of the large bore mri machine are critical to ensure image quality. Homogeneities of the magnetic field, radiofrequency calibration, and software releases need to be undertaken from time to time. The large bore mri machine also need preventive maintenance to identify wear trends in cables and components at an early stage.

FAQ

  • Q: Why do MRI machines make loud noises during scans? A: The noises come from the rapid switching of gradient coils that generate precise magnetic fields necessary for capturing detailed images.

    Q: Can MRI scans be done with contrast agents? A: Yes, sometimes contrast agents like gadolinium are used to highlight specific tissues or blood vessels, improving visibility of certain conditions.

    Q: How should MRI machines be maintained? A: Regular calibration, cryogen level checks, and environmental control are essential for maintaining stable magnetic performance and image accuracy.

    Q: Is MRI safe during pregnancy? A: MRI is typically considered safe during pregnancy, especially after the first trimester, but contrast agents are usually avoided unless medically necessary.

    Q: Can MRI be used in veterinary medicine? A: Yes, MRI is widely used in veterinary hospitals to diagnose brain, spine, and joint conditions in animals with the same precision as in human medicine.
